Mountain Icon opens Adventure-Land 4x4 course at the Motorshow

Designed and built by award-winning marketing agency Brandscape, this demanding off-road course offers the ultimate driving challenge themed around urban regeneration.
The 750-metre long course features nine demanding obstacles including a water crossing, log articulation section, gravel pit and a terrifying 12-metre high bridge. The action packed course has been designed to push the off-roaders to their limits in five challenging minutes of pure excitement.
Paul Lloyd, Head of Off Road at Brandscape and the mastermind behind Adventure-Land, said this about the course: "This is one of the finest 4X4 courses of its type. The British International Motor Show gave us the opportunity to develop some really challenging off road obstacles to showcase the world’s best 4X4s to show visitors. Adventure-Land offers a dynamic and exciting dimension to the show".
Opening Adventure-Land on Wednesday 19th July at 11am will be Alan Hinkes, OBE, the only British climber to conquer the world’s highest mountains. Having driven the purpose-built course Alan commented: "I haven’t had this much excitement since reaching the top of Everest".
